You are viewing a plain text version of this content. The canonical link for it is here.
Posted to commits@helix.apache.org by jx...@apache.org on 2021/11/21 10:18:07 UTC

[helix] branch master updated: upgrade maven-site-plugin: fix site.xml head/footer (#1910)

This is an automated email from the ASF dual-hosted git repository.

jxue pushed a commit to branch master
in repository https://gitbox.apache.org/repos/asf/helix.git


The following commit(s) were added to refs/heads/master by this push:
     new 9249a90  upgrade maven-site-plugin: fix site.xml head/footer (#1910)
9249a90 is described below

commit 9249a90c28b17cff9de405165709230b708ce370
Author: Hervé Boutemy <hb...@apache.org>
AuthorDate: Sun Nov 21 11:18:01 2021 +0100

    upgrade maven-site-plugin: fix site.xml head/footer (#1910)
---
 website/0.8.0/src/site/site.xml |  8 ++++----
 website/0.8.1/src/site/site.xml |  8 ++++----
 website/0.8.2/src/site/site.xml |  8 ++++----
 website/1.0.2/src/site/site.xml |  8 ++++----
 website/pom.xml                 | 12 ------------
 website/src/site/site.xml       |  8 ++++----
 6 files changed, 20 insertions(+), 32 deletions(-)

diff --git a/website/0.8.0/src/site/site.xml b/website/0.8.0/src/site/site.xml
index 7b39934..bcf0b8a 100644
--- a/website/0.8.0/src/site/site.xml
+++ b/website/0.8.0/src/site/site.xml
@@ -38,7 +38,7 @@
 
   <body>
 
-    <head>
+    <head><![CDATA[
       <script type="text/javascript">
 
         var _gaq = _gaq || [];
@@ -53,7 +53,7 @@
 
       </script>
 
-    </head>
+    ]]></head>
 
     <breadcrumbs position="left">
       <item name="Apache Helix" href="http://helix.apache.org/"/>
@@ -95,12 +95,12 @@
       <item name="Thanks" href="http://www.apache.org/foundation/thanks.html"/>
     </menu>
 -->
-    <footer>
+    <footer><![CDATA[
       <div class="row span16"><div>Apache Helix, Apache, the Apache feather logo, and the Apache Helix project logos are trademarks of The Apache Software Foundation.
         All other marks mentioned may be trademarks or registered trademarks of their respective owners.</div>
         <a href="${project.url}/privacy-policy.html">Privacy Policy</a>
       </div>
-    </footer>
+    ]]></footer>
 
 
   </body>
diff --git a/website/0.8.1/src/site/site.xml b/website/0.8.1/src/site/site.xml
index f58e282..e611568 100644
--- a/website/0.8.1/src/site/site.xml
+++ b/website/0.8.1/src/site/site.xml
@@ -38,7 +38,7 @@
 
   <body>
 
-    <head>
+    <head><![CDATA[
       <script type="text/javascript">
 
         var _gaq = _gaq || [];
@@ -53,7 +53,7 @@
 
       </script>
 
-    </head>
+    ]]></head>
 
     <breadcrumbs position="left">
       <item name="Apache Helix" href="http://helix.apache.org/"/>
@@ -95,12 +95,12 @@
       <item name="Thanks" href="http://www.apache.org/foundation/thanks.html"/>
     </menu>
 -->
-    <footer>
+    <footer><![CDATA[
       <div class="row span16"><div>Apache Helix, Apache, the Apache feather logo, and the Apache Helix project logos are trademarks of The Apache Software Foundation.
         All other marks mentioned may be trademarks or registered trademarks of their respective owners.</div>
         <a href="${project.url}/privacy-policy.html">Privacy Policy</a>
       </div>
-    </footer>
+    ]]></footer>
 
 
   </body>
diff --git a/website/0.8.2/src/site/site.xml b/website/0.8.2/src/site/site.xml
index 216afef..724e55d 100644
--- a/website/0.8.2/src/site/site.xml
+++ b/website/0.8.2/src/site/site.xml
@@ -38,7 +38,7 @@
 
   <body>
 
-    <head>
+    <head><![CDATA[
       <script type="text/javascript">
 
         var _gaq = _gaq || [];
@@ -53,7 +53,7 @@
 
       </script>
 
-    </head>
+    ]]></head>
 
     <breadcrumbs position="left">
       <item name="Apache Helix" href="http://helix.apache.org/"/>
@@ -95,12 +95,12 @@
       <item name="Thanks" href="http://www.apache.org/foundation/thanks.html"/>
     </menu>
 -->
-    <footer>
+    <footer><![CDATA[
       <div class="row span16"><div>Apache Helix, Apache, the Apache feather logo, and the Apache Helix project logos are trademarks of The Apache Software Foundation.
         All other marks mentioned may be trademarks or registered trademarks of their respective owners.</div>
         <a href="${project.url}/privacy-policy.html">Privacy Policy</a>
       </div>
-    </footer>
+    ]]></footer>
 
 
   </body>
diff --git a/website/1.0.2/src/site/site.xml b/website/1.0.2/src/site/site.xml
index 3fa8657..6a6c052 100644
--- a/website/1.0.2/src/site/site.xml
+++ b/website/1.0.2/src/site/site.xml
@@ -38,7 +38,7 @@
 
   <body>
 
-    <head>
+    <head><![CDATA[
       <script type="text/javascript">
 
         var _gaq = _gaq || [];
@@ -52,7 +52,7 @@
         })();
 
       </script>
-    </head>
+    ]]></head>
 
     <breadcrumbs position="left">
       <item name="Apache Helix" href="http://helix.apache.org/"/>
@@ -94,12 +94,12 @@
       <item name="Thanks" href="http://www.apache.org/foundation/thanks.html"/>
     </menu>
 -->
-    <footer>
+    <footer><![CDATA[
       <div class="row span16"><div>Apache Helix, Apache, the Apache feather logo, and the Apache Helix project logos are trademarks of The Apache Software Foundation.
         All other marks mentioned may be trademarks or registered trademarks of their respective owners.</div>
         <a href="${project.url}/privacy-policy.html">Privacy Policy</a>
       </div>
-    </footer>
+    ]]></footer>
 
 
   </body>
diff --git a/website/pom.xml b/website/pom.xml
index 310d268..7cc4906 100644
--- a/website/pom.xml
+++ b/website/pom.xml
@@ -80,23 +80,12 @@
       <plugin>
         <groupId>org.apache.maven.plugins</groupId>
         <artifactId>maven-site-plugin</artifactId>
-        <version>3.3</version>
         <dependencies>
           <dependency>
             <groupId>lt.velykis.maven.skins</groupId>
             <artifactId>reflow-velocity-tools</artifactId>
             <version>1.0.0</version>
           </dependency>
-          <dependency>
-            <groupId>org.apache.velocity</groupId>
-            <artifactId>velocity</artifactId>
-            <version>1.7</version>
-          </dependency>
-          <dependency>
-            <groupId>org.apache.maven.doxia</groupId>
-            <artifactId>doxia-module-markdown</artifactId>
-            <version>1.3</version>
-          </dependency>
         </dependencies>
       </plugin>
     </plugins>
@@ -105,7 +94,6 @@
         <plugin>
           <groupId>org.apache.maven.plugins</groupId>
           <artifactId>maven-scm-publish-plugin</artifactId>
-          <version>1.0</version>
           <configuration>
             <tryUpdate>true</tryUpdate>
             <providerImplementations>
diff --git a/website/src/site/site.xml b/website/src/site/site.xml
index 6a23758..38787c8 100644
--- a/website/src/site/site.xml
+++ b/website/src/site/site.xml
@@ -37,7 +37,7 @@
   </skin>
 
   <body>
-    <head>
+    <head><![CDATA[
       <script type="text/javascript">
 
         var _gaq = _gaq || [];
@@ -51,7 +51,7 @@
         })();
 
       </script>
-    </head>
+    ]]></head>
 
     <breadcrumbs position="left">
       <item name="Apache Helix" href="http://helix.apache.org/"/>
@@ -118,12 +118,12 @@
       <item name="Thanks" href="http://www.apache.org/foundation/thanks.html"/>
       <item name="Security" href="http://www.apache.org/security/"/>
     </menu>
-    <footer>
+    <footer><![CDATA[
       <div class="row span16"><div>Apache Helix, Apache, the Apache feather logo, and the Apache Helix project logos are trademarks of The Apache Software Foundation.
         All other marks mentioned may be trademarks or registered trademarks of their respective owners.</div>
         <a href="${project.url}/privacy-policy.html">Privacy Policy</a>
       </div>
-    </footer>
+    ]]></footer>
 
 
   </body>